Harlem Rent Report — October 2023
Asking rents in ZIP 10026, New York City, from 174 listings.
Median 1BR rent in Harlem was $2,800 in October 2023, up 16.7% (+$400) from September 2023 and up 12.0% year-over-year. The middle half of 1BR listings asked between $2,495 and $3,208. That puts Harlem $350 above the New York City citywide 1BR median of $2,450. The month's figures are based on 174 listings across 12 bedroom categories.
